While Blue Origin hasn’t announced how much the new station will cost to build and operate, it says it is splitting the load between a number of other companies.

Sierra Space will use its Dream Chaser spaceplane for crew and cargo transportation, will operate a module and use its Starliner spacecraft for transport, and Genesis Engineering will run tourist flights to the station.

Blue Origin will also work with Redwire Space and Arizona State University on the planned station.

Orbital Reef hopes to “start operating in the second half of this decade.”
